bf/NASDAQ:EFSC_icon.png

NASDAQ:EFSC

Enterprise Financial Services Corp

  • Stock

USD

Last Close

50.86

25/09 14:38

Market Cap

1.51B

Beta: 1.13

Volume Today

16.80K

Avg: 166.24K

PE Ratio

7.66

PFCF: 6.51

Dividend Yield

2.52%

Payout:15.89%

Preview

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page

Subscribe NowHelp
Dec '13
Dec '14
Dec '15
Dec '16
Dec '17
Dec '18
Dec '19
Dec '20
Dec '21
Dec '22
Dec '23
revenue
145.05M
-
134.00M
7.62%
141.09M
5.29%
164.55M
16.63%
211.70M
28.65%
230.25M
8.76%
287.89M
25.03%
324.50M
12.72%
427.94M
31.87%
471.35M
10.14%
68.72M
85.42%
cost of revenue
1.04M
-
gross profit
144.01M
-
134.00M
6.95%
141.09M
5.29%
164.55M
16.63%
211.70M
28.65%
230.25M
8.76%
287.89M
25.03%
324.50M
12.72%
427.94M
31.87%
471.35M
10.14%
68.72M
85.42%
selling and marketing expenses
general and administrative expenses
47.28M
-
48.43M
2.44%
49.29M
1.77%
49.85M
1.13%
61.39M
23.16%
66.04M
7.58%
81.30M
23.10%
92.29M
13.52%
124.90M
35.34%
147.03M
17.71%
5.72M
96.11%
selling general and administrative expenses
47.28M
-
48.43M
2.44%
49.29M
1.77%
49.85M
1.13%
61.39M
23.16%
66.04M
7.58%
81.30M
23.10%
92.29M
13.52%
124.90M
35.34%
147.03M
17.71%
5.72M
96.11%
research and development expenses
other expenses
-155.41M
-
-253.15M
62.89%
-324.85M
28.32%
-384.21M
18.27%
-109.55M
71.49%
177.80M
262.31%
cost and expenses
5.92M
-
3.83M
35.39%
3.46M
9.41%
3.83M
10.39%
3.81M
0.31%
-79.78M
2,192.26%
-171.86M
115.42%
-232.56M
35.32%
-259.30M
11.50%
7.08M
102.73%
177.80M
2,411.67%
operating expenses
4.88M
-
3.83M
21.55%
3.46M
9.41%
3.83M
10.39%
3.81M
0.31%
-79.78M
2,192.26%
-171.86M
115.42%
-232.56M
35.32%
-259.30M
11.50%
7.08M
102.73%
177.80M
2,411.67%
interest expense
18.14M
-
14.39M
20.68%
12.37M
14.02%
13.73M
11.00%
25.23M
83.81%
45.90M
81.88%
66.42M
44.71%
34.78M
47.64%
23.04M
33.76%
41.18M
78.76%
202.33M
391.34%
ebitda
72.91M
-
58.92M
19.18%
73.88M
25.39%
91.92M
24.42%
117.64M
27.98%
156.51M
33.04%
127.30M
18.66%
103.77M
18.48%
182.78M
76.14%
253.68M
38.79%
246.53M
2.82%
operating income
68.22M
-
55.43M
18.74%
70.77M
27.67%
88.57M
25.15%
111.75M
26.18%
150.47M
34.65%
116.04M
22.89%
91.95M
20.76%
168.63M
83.40%
239.67M
42.13%
246.53M
2.86%
depreciation and amortization
4.69M
-
3.49M
25.51%
3.11M
10.91%
3.35M
7.75%
5.89M
75.72%
6.04M
2.46%
11.26M
86.61%
11.82M
5.00%
14.15M
19.64%
14.01M
1.00%
9.69M
30.81%
total other income expenses net
-18.14M
-
-14.39M
20.68%
-12.37M
14.02%
-13.73M
11.00%
-25.23M
83.81%
-45.90M
81.88%
116.04M
352.82%
91.95M
20.76%
168.63M
83.40%
19.79M
88.27%
246.53M
1,145.90%
income before tax
50.08M
-
41.04M
18.04%
58.40M
42.29%
74.84M
28.15%
86.52M
15.60%
104.58M
20.87%
116.04M
10.96%
91.95M
20.76%
168.63M
83.40%
259.46M
53.86%
246.53M
4.98%
income tax expense
16.98M
-
13.87M
18.29%
19.95M
43.83%
26.00M
30.33%
38.33M
47.40%
15.36M
59.92%
23.30M
51.67%
17.56M
24.61%
35.58M
102.57%
56.42M
58.57%
52.47M
7.00%
net income
33.10M
-
27.17M
17.92%
38.45M
41.50%
48.84M
27.01%
48.19M
1.32%
89.22M
85.14%
92.74M
3.95%
74.38M
19.79%
133.06M
78.88%
203.04M
52.60%
194.06M
4.42%
weighted average shs out
18.60M
-
19.69M
5.88%
20.03M
1.70%
20.02M
0.05%
22.95M
14.65%
23.11M
0.72%
26.05M
12.68%
26.95M
3.49%
34.44M
27.76%
37.38M
8.55%
37.37M
0.03%
weighted average shs out dil
19.14M
-
20.13M
5.19%
20.34M
1.07%
20.26M
0.39%
23.28M
14.88%
23.29M
0.06%
26.16M
12.30%
26.99M
3.17%
34.50M
27.82%
37.50M
8.71%
37.51M
0.02%
eps
1.78
-
1.38
22.47%
1.92
39.13%
2.44
27.08%
2.10
13.93%
3.86
83.81%
3.56
7.77%
2.76
22.47%
3.86
39.86%
5.32
37.82%
5.09
4.32%
epsdiluted
1.73
-
1.35
21.97%
1.89
40.00%
2.41
27.51%
2.07
14.11%
3.83
85.02%
3.55
7.31%
2.76
22.25%
3.86
39.86%
5.31
37.56%
5.07
4.52%

All numbers in USD (except ratios and percentages)